

ダウォン文化センター
Nestled in Roppongi, the Dawon Cultural Center offers an authentic immersion into Korean culture right in the heart of Tokyo. Visitors can participate in a variety of workshops, from learning the Korean language and traditional cooking to experiencing folk arts and crafts. It's a vibrant hub for cultural exchange, perfect for those seeking to deepen their understanding of Korea.
Many classes require advance booking, especially popular cooking or language sessions, so check their website beforehand. Embrace the opportunity to interact with instructors and fellow participants for a richer experience.
| Admission fee | Free |
| Access | Roppongi Station (Tokyo Metro Hibiya Line, Toei Oedo Line), Exit 3 or 1C. Approximately 5-7 minute walk. |
| Opening hours | weekdays: Monday: 10:00 AM – 9:00 PM,Tuesday: 10:00 AM – 9:00 PM,Wednesday: 10:00 AM – 9:00 PM,Thursday: 10:00 AM – 9:00 PM,Friday: 10:00 AM – 9:00 PM,Saturday: 9:00 AM – 9:00 PM,Sunday: 9:00 AM – 9:00 PM |
